High Tensile & Hardness Carbon Steel Material
Made of Q235 carbon steel with hardened treatment and black oxide finish. Compared to ordinary low-carbon steel screws, this product offers higher tensile strength (Grade 4.8 ≥400MPa, Grade 8.8 ≥800MPa) and increased hardness to prevent thread stripping or head breakage. When driving into hardwood or composite panels, its high strength ensures smooth penetration without deformation – strong and durable for heavy-load connections in furniture and construction.
Metal Material for Tightening & Anti-Loosening
The carbon steel substrate is heat-treated for excellent elastic limit and torsional strength. The self-tapping sharp thread bites deeply into wood fibers during driving, creating a "female thread" locking effect. Metal material never ages or becomes brittle, maintaining secure fastening under long-term vibration or temperature changes (e.g., outdoor wood structures, movable furniture). High preload is retained after tightening for reliable, long-lasting connections.
Long Service Life with High Wear Resistance
Black oxide finishing increases surface hardness and provides self-lubricating properties, reducing friction wear between the screw and wood during assembly. The countersunk Phillips head fully embeds into the wood surface, preventing tool slippage or head damage. Proven in durability tests, the threads withstand repeated driving and removal without significant wear. Compared to common zinc-plated wood screws, this product offers superior wear resistance and lower replacement frequency in outdoor or repetitive-use applications.
